Goa, July 15 -- The Bombay High Court at Goa has dismissed a petition filed by Rupa Jitendra Deshprabhu, wife of former MLA Jitendra Deshprabhu, in connection with a long-standing property dispute. The court also imposed a cost of Rs.20,000 on her, stating that the plea was a clear attempt to delay the execution of an eviction decree passed as far back as 2009.

In a strong observation, the High Court criticized the petition as lacking merit and being strategically filed to stall the legal process. It emphasized that justice cannot be denied to the decree-holder through deliberate litigation tactics.
